WebHow Do Peregrine Falcons Fly So Fast? Keel Peregrine falcons have very large keels. The larger the keel, the more muscles and flapping power a bird has, and the faster it is able to fly. Wing Shape Peregrine falcons have high-speed … WebDec 3, 2024 · The top speed of a peregrine falcon is about 200 to 240 mph (320 to 390 kph). They reach this speed when diving down for prey. WebAug 11, 2024 · A quick, easy way to distinguish falcons from other birds is how they fly. Falcons do not flap their wings much at all, they use the thermals in the air to soar in. They stay close to the cliff and rarely fly in tight circles like turkey vultures do. Also, falcons are fairly small (only about the size of a crow) with ‘M’ shaped wings.
